tpwallet官网下载-tp官方下载最新版本/最新版本/安卓版下载安装|你的通用数字钱包-tpwallet
TP导入总失败,问题常常并非“导入动作不对”,而是导入背后的系统链路在某个环节被卡住:解析、校验、签名、路由、写入、回执、再到风控与对账。把这些环节按“可验证证据”拆开,你会发现故障点会越来越清晰。下面用一套教程式思路,把排查路径拉直,同时把前瞻性数字技术、账户监控、分片技术、安全技术、行业研究、交易与支付、DApp分类这些维度串起来,帮助你不仅修好这次,也为后续建立可复用的排障体系。

先从“前瞻性数字技术”入手:很多团队把TP导入当作纯数据迁移,却忽略了链上/支付侧常用的是“可追溯状态机”。你导入的并不是一次性文件,而是带有状态转移条件的请求。常见失败表现有两类:一类是格式或字段校验失败(例如账户标识、网络链ID、nonce/高度不匹配);另一类是状态机拒绝(例如账户余额/权限不足、交易队列拥塞、签名过期)。教程化做法是:每次失败都要保留原始请求体、返回码、返回日志、链上交易哈希/批次号,并把它们映射到状态机步骤。这样你才能判断是“输入不合格”还是“业务条件不满足”。
接着做“账户监控”。TP导入的失败,经常是账户状态不是你以为的状态:账户被暂停、额度紧张、地址已更换、权限被撤销、或监控系统判定存在异常操作。建议你把监控落到可观测指标:账户余额变化曲线、最近N笔交易成功率、失败原因分布、以及同一批次导入的重复请求次数。若发现失败集中出现在某个时间窗,优先检查交易与支付通道是否触发限频或风控冷却期。这里也要做“行业研究”的思维:不同支付通道与链上网关的策略差异很大,有的对突发导入更敏感,有的对签名验证更严格。你要把失败率和通道/网络环境关联起来,而不是只盯导入代码。
然后是“分片技术”。当导入数据量大、或包含多账户多资产时,系统可能采用分片处理:每个分片各自校验、签名、广播与确认。失败有时发生在某个分片,而你只看到整体失败。做法是:把导入批次拆成更小分片,并记录每个分片的校验通过率和回执延迟。若分片越小成功率越高,说明存在“单批资源上限/交易队列拥塞/网关超时”问题;若某些分片总是失败且错误码一致,通常是字段/账户权限在该分片中不满足条件。通过分片定位,你能把“全局问题”变成“局部问题”,修复会快很多。
安全技术是另一条高频原因。导入失败可能来自:签名算法不一致、时间戳偏差、重放保护触发、或密钥轮换后仍在使用旧配置。建议你检查三件事:1)签名域参数是否与目标网络一致;2)nonce/高度是否从链上实时获取;3)密钥是否发生了轮换,且导入服务是否热更新生效。额外注意CSRF/鉴权过期、回调校验失败等“支付侧安全策略”。当你在交易与支付模块看到类似“验签失败”“回调签名不匹配”,基本就能确定在安全校验链上出了差错。
最后把“DApp分类”纳入排查框架。不同DApp类型对导入的触发与依赖不同:有的偏账户型(需要权限与授权),有的偏资产型(需要余额与合约执行权限),有的偏支付型(需要通道与风控策略)。你可以按分类对齐失败语义:
- 账户型DApp:重点看权限/授权/账户监控;
- 资产型DApp:重点看余额、合约可执行性与分片执行回执;
- 支付型DApp:重点看交易与支付通道状态、安全校验与限频。
把以上维度形成“证据表”:每次失败记录失败码、链上或网关回执、账户状态、分片编号、以及对应DApp类型。持续迭代后,你会发现TP导入失败不再是玄学,而是可以被系统化定位与修复的工程问题。
你也可以按下面方式立即行动:
1)用最小分片复现失败,先确认错误码稳定性;
2)对失败分片对应账户做监控核对(余额/权限/最近成功率);

3)核对签名与nonce获取来源(是否实时、是否与网络一致);
4)如果涉及支付通道,检查限频/队列拥塞与回调验签;
5)按DApp分类对齐失败原因,避免“只改导入参数”却错过链路层根因。
互动投票:
1)你遇到的TP导入失败更像哪类:格式校验?还是回执/签名类?
2)失败是否集中在大批量导入时出现:是/否?
3)你当前是否有账户监控面板:有/没有?
4)你希望我下一篇重点讲:分片策略优化,还是安全签名与nonce治理?
5)给我投票:你最常见的失败错误码是哪一个?(填字/截图描述均可)
评论